Abstract/Summary

The archive on a programme of archaeological monitoring and recording that was undertaken on land at Abbey Farm, Duckpool Lane, Stixwold. The work was undertaken prior to work to re-route overhead electric lines underground. The work was undertaken in proximity to the 12th century Cistercian nunnery. The deposits found were primarily natural. The western portion revealed a group of rough limestone blocks with sandy mortar, which was interpretated as a possible wall footing or a rubble dump. No finds were encountered.
